In the realm of economics, understanding various concepts is crucial for analyzing the health of an economy. One such concept is the deflationary gap; deflation gap, which refers to a situation where the actual output of an economy is less than its potential output due to a decrease in demand. This gap indicates that resources are not being utilized efficiently, leading to higher unemployment rates and underutilized capital. When there is a deflationary gap; deflation gap, it often results in falling prices, as businesses lower their prices in an attempt to attract consumers who are hesitant to spend. The existence of a deflationary gap; deflation gap can be detrimental to economic growth. When consumers expect prices to continue falling, they may delay purchases, leading to a further decline in demand. This creates a vicious cycle where businesses earn less revenue, prompting them to cut costs, which often means laying off workers. The increased unemployment then leads to even less spending, perpetuating the deflationary gap; deflation gap. Therefore, it is essential for policymakers to recognize this phenomenon and implement measures to stimulate demand.Governments and central banks can take several approaches to close a deflationary gap; deflation gap. One common method is through monetary policy, where the central bank may lower interest rates to encourage borrowing and spending. Lower interest rates make loans cheaper for both consumers and businesses, incentivizing them to invest and consume more, which can help close the gap. Additionally, fiscal policy can play a significant role; governments can increase public spending on infrastructure projects or provide tax cuts to boost disposable income for households.It is important to monitor the indicators that suggest the presence of a deflationary gap; deflation gap. For instance, if inflation rates are negative or stagnant, and GDP growth is sluggish, these can be signs that an economy is facing a deflationary gap; deflation gap. Analysts and economists also look at employment figures, consumer confidence, and production levels to gauge the overall economic health. In conclusion, the deflationary gap; deflation gap is a critical concept in economics that highlights the disparity between actual and potential output in an economy. Understanding this gap is vital for implementing effective policies aimed at stimulating growth and preventing prolonged periods of economic stagnation. By recognizing the signs of a deflationary gap; deflation gap and taking appropriate action, governments and policymakers can work towards fostering a healthier economic environment that benefits all citizens.
